What’s a QR Code?

A QR code is a so-called Quick Response Code. This barcode is made on the basis of a two-dimensional matrix. The code of the QR Code leads the visitor to a certain page or sets a certain action in motion.

You can compare such a QR Code with a QR code in a restaurant. More and more restaurants are choosing to place such a QR code on, for example, the tables. If you scan such a QR code, you will see the menu on your smartphone. Convenient, affordable for the restaurant and also environmentally friendly.

What’s a QR code useful for on my website?

You can now also process such a QR code in your WordPress website. Why would you want this? There are many reasons for this. The most important reason is to refer a visitor to a specific page. You can also use a QR code to initiate a desired action.

An example of such a desired action is referring the visitor to the app store. In the app store, the visitor can directly download the app of your company or webshop. This is just one of the many examples of actions that you can process in a QR code.

The most important advantage of a QR code can be found in the convenience. All the visitor has to do is scan the QR code. After the visitor has done this, the desired action is immediately carried out for him / her – convenience serves the human being.

A QR code also ensures a connection between the PC and the smartphone. Does the visitor end up on your website on his /her PC? And does he/she see a QR code there? By scanning this QR code, the desired action is immediately performed on the smartphone. This creates a perfect connection between PC / laptop and smartphone / tablet.

Plugins

Do these benefits and possibilities appeal to you? By using one of the QR code plugins below, you can easily generate and place the QR code on your website:

  • Kaya QR Code Generator: with this generator you can generate a QR code pretty quickly and easily. You can then place this QR code on your pages, posts, in a sidebar or in a WooCommerce product. This plugin is also available in Dutch.
  • UPI QR Code Payment Gateway: if you have a WooCommerce webshop, this plugin is interesting. With this plugin, your visitors pay for an order quickly and easily in your webshop. Again, ‘convenience serves man’ applies to this.
  • Simple QR Code Generator Widget: if you want to keep it as simple as possible, you can also choose this plugin. The operation of this plugin is incredibly simple, but this plugin is not available in Dutch.
